Increasing affordable housing – Shelter NSW steps up to support local government

With plans for significant growth in housing supply across Greater Sydney by 2036, pressure is on local government is mounting. Shelter NSW has recently stepped up its efforts to support local government to better support the delivery of affordable housing. 

A recently developed training package focuses on stronger interventions for uptake of affordable housing via the planning system, through council’s initiatives and joint ventures.

The first Council to receive the training was Georges River. Shelter’s role was to inform the new elected Councillors about how a strong Affordable Housing Scheme will help meet the currently unmet demand for key workers in the significant education, health and retail sectors, while helping to sustain a diverse local community within the LGA.
